Transaction ad62ffeb81608cb04d0f8f21aa7eb5c84dd886ab52df2d454da54451bcaf20bf
1 Input
1 Output
-
ad62ffeb81608cb04d0f8f21aa7eb5c84dd886ab52df2d454da54451bcaf20bf:0
- value
- 2363957
- script pubkey
- OP_0 OP_PUSHBYTES_32 477e84d4e6a15d1f072b57e1fbf1785e852a88c15fddfa440dfb42be12598a1b
- address
- bc1qgalgf48x59w37pet2lslhutct6zj4zxptlwl53qdldptuyje3gds6gm0zp